So, what is de lait ecreme?
Dé lait écrémé, which translates to "skimmed milk" in English, is a popular dairy product that has been stripped of its cream content, resulting in a lower fat content than whole milk. Skimmed milk is an excellent source of calcium, vitamins D and B12, and protein, making it a popular choice for those looking to maintain a healthy diet. It is commonly used in cooking and baking, as well as for drinking. Its light, slightly sweet taste and low-calorie content make it a versatile ingredient for various recipes, including smoothies, sauces, and desserts.
